I. Conget et al., PREFERENTIAL ALTERATION OF D-[2-H-3] GLUCOSE DETRITIATION RELATIVE TOD-[5-H-3] GLUCOSE-UTILIZATION IN ERYTHROCYTES OF DIABETIC-PATIENTS, Diabetes, nutrition & metabolism, 6(2), 1993, pp. 71-75
In erythrocytes from both normal and diabetic subjects, the production
of (HOH)-H-3 from D-[2-H-3]glucose is lower than that from D-[5-H-3]g
lucose. Moreover, the ratio between (HOH)-H-3 generation from D-[2-H-3
]glucose/D-[5-H-3] glucose is lower in hyperglycemic diabetic patients
than normal subjects and is restored to the control value after impro
vement of metabolism control. The altered ratio found in the diabetic
subjects prior to treatment probably reflects an intracellular environ
mental change rather than intrinsic anomaly of phosphoglucoisomerase.
These findings indicate that the generation of (HOH)-H-3 from D-[2-H-3
]glucose underestimate the rate of D-glucose phosphorylation more seve
rely in diabetic than normal subjects.
